System size depends on your home's square footage, insulation, window placement, and local climate. We perform a detailed load calculation and recommend the right capacity to avoid oversizing (which wastes energy) or undersizing (which leaves you uncomfortable). Anne Arundel County's humidity requires proper sizing for both cooling and dehumidification.

Spring tune-up before cooling season and fall tune-up before heating season are ideal. This keeps your system efficient, catches wear early, and prevents emergency breakdowns. We offer simple maintenance plans so you don't have to remember to call.
Tank models store and keep water hot, with lower upfront cost but ongoing standby energy loss. Tankless heaters warm water on-demand, use less energy, save space, and last longer—but cost more to buy. We help you choose based on household size, budget, and space.
We assess both options fairly. If your system is under 10 years old and the repair is minor, repair often makes sense. If it's older, breaks frequently, or the repair cost approaches replacement cost, upgrading to a newer, efficient model usually saves you money long-term.
